[Andrew McAfee] Facebook on the Intranet? No ” Facebook AS the Intranet. : Andrew ...: I think a Facebook-like framework definitely has merit inside the firewall, and Facebook itself certainly has a more elegant approach to some things on traditional Intranets, but in many ways it's a round hole for a square peg. Easier to create your own facebook-like framework (or get one off-the-shelf from many of the vendors entering this space), than it is to rebuild many of the core services most Intranets provide on Facebook's platfrom, IMO.
